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Page title was updated because corresponding version was renamed.

...

...

How can I update the course completion when the activity completion status changes?

Problem

When changing the activity completion from complete to incomplete, the course completion still shows the user's status as complete. The certification and program completion also continues to show as complete and is not updated by the amended activity completion.

Course completion scenario

  1. Change the activity completion of a seminar from 'Fully attended' to 'No Show' (for example when the initial status was entered incorrectly and needs to be amended).
  2. As a result of the updated activity completion status the user now fails to meet course completion criteria.
  3. This course completion does not recalculate automatically on the next cron run using the scheduled task core\task\completion_regular_task.

Program/certification scenario

  • Staff have a breach of policy within the certified period
  • Staff completed re-certification before the window period opens
  • Course content changes mid-way through a certification period
  • Human-error issues

Solution

Possible solutions and workarounds for course completion:

...

Possible solution and workaround for program/certification completion status:

  • You can use the program and certification completion editor to manually edit program/certification completion dates for individual users. Course, program and certification completion reaggregation is currently not expected to automatically change states from complete to any other incomplete status (unless the window period for certifications re-opens). 

Related articles